라디오 단추

라디오 버튼(radio button) 또는 옵션 버튼(option button)[1]은 사용자가 미리 정의된 상호 배타적인 옵션 세트 중에서 단 하나만 선택할 수 있도록 하는 그래픽 컨트롤 요소이다.[2] 라디오 버튼의 단일 선택 특성은 사용자가 여러 항목을 자유롭게 선택하거나 해제할 수 있는 체크 상자와 구별된다.
라디오 버튼은 두 개 이상의 그룹으로 배열되며, 화면에는 예를 들어 공백(미선택 시) 또는 점(선택 시)을 포함할 수 있는 원형 구멍 목록으로 표시된다. 각 라디오 버튼에는 일반적으로 해당 라디오 버튼이 나타내는 선택 사항을 설명하는 레이블이 수반된다. 선택 사항은 상호 배타적이다. 사용자가 하나의 라디오 버튼을 선택하면 동일한 그룹 내에서 이전에 선택되었던 라디오 버튼은 자동으로 선택이 해제되어 단 하나만 선택된 상태가 된다. 라디오 버튼의 선택은 버튼이나 캡션을 마우스로 클릭(또는 화면 터치)하거나 키보드 단축키를 사용하여 수행된다.
어원
[편집]
라디오 버튼이라는 이름은 미리 설정된 방송국을 선택하기 위해 라디오에서 사용되었던 물리적 버튼에서 따온 것이다.[3][2] 버튼 하나를 누르면 이전에 눌려 있던 다른 버튼들이 튀어나오고 방금 누른 버튼만 들어간 상태로 남게 된다.
HTML
[편집]웹 양식에서 라디오 버튼을 표시하기 위해 HTML 요소인 <input type="radio">가 사용된다. 예시:
<form>
<input type="radio" name="season" value="winter" id="winter" checked>
<label for="winter">Winter</label>
<input type="radio" name="season" value="spring" id="spring">
<label for="spring">Spring</label>
<input type="radio" name="season" value="summer" id="summer">
<label for="summer">Summer</label>
<input type="radio" name="season" value="autumn" id="autumn">
<label for="autumn">Autumn</label>
</form>
속성 그룹은 name에 의해 정의된다. 하나의 그룹 안에서는 단 하나의 라디오 버튼만 선택할 수 있다.
유니코드
[편집]유니코드 표준 버전에는 기호 및 픽토그램 섹션의 코드 (U)에 라디오 버튼을 나타내기 위해 지정된 문자가 포함되어 있다. 유사한 문자로는 수학 연산자인 U+2299 ⊙ CIRCLED DOT OPERATOR와 U+25C9 ◉ FISHEYE, U+25CE ◎ BULLSEYE 등이 있다.
같이 보기
[편집]각주
[편집]- ↑ “About Option Buttons”. 《docs.oracle.com》. 2025년 2월 2일에 확인함.
- 1 2 “Radio Buttons”. 《Windows Dev Center》. 2016년 9월 14일에 확인함.
- ↑ Yumashev, Alex. “The history of a radio-button”. 《JitBit Founders Blog》. 2016년 9월 14일에 확인함.
외부 링크
[편집]- (영어) 부적절한 용어: Radial Button 보관됨 2008-10-21 - 웨이백 머신